Name: Miguel
Species: Morelet's Crocodile (Crocodylus morletii)
Group: Tropical Trail

You know him, you love him, it's Miguel the Morelet's Crocodile!🐊 In the famous words of Steve Irwin, "CROCS RULE!" Steve was always a major inspiration for me and seeing him work with crocodiles made me want to one day follow in his footsteps. Thanks to starting Didgeri Zoo I was finally able to achieve that goal with a crocodile that is native to same place as my family. Morelet's Crocodiles are found on the east coast of Mexico to the Yucatan peninsula in freshwater environments such as swamps and lakes. They are 1 of 3 crocodiles native to North America with the American Crocodile and Cuban Crocodile being the other 2. Because Miguel is still a baby his diet mostly consist of insects, small fish, shrimp and baby mice. You can always see Miguel at our pop up market appearances and if you book us for any event. Keep up with the zoo because soon Miguel won't be the only crocodilian.

Name: Terri
Species:Northern Blue Tongue Skink (Tiliqua scincoides intermedia)
Group: Outback Pack

Next up is one of my favorite Australian reptiles. People often confuse Blue Tongue Skinks for snakes but in reality they are lizards. A unique adaptation they have is their namesake Blue Tongue which they stick out in order to scare and confuse predators. Terri is part of our Australian Big 3.

Name: Billy The Frilly
Species: Frilled Dragon (Chlamydosaurus kingii)
Group: Outback Pack

Billy is a Frilled Dragon also known as a Frill Neck Lizard which native to Northern Australia and New Guinea. Frilled Dragons are medium sized arboreal lizards that are found in rainforest and savannahs on trees. They are carnivores that eat bugs, small mammals, and lizards. Unlike many Filled Dragons Billy is extremely tame and loves climbing on top peoples heads, for this reason we don't allow small children to handle him because he moved a lot. His favorite food is crickets, dubia roaches and pinky mice. Billy is a member of our Australian Big 3.

Name: Ozzie
Species: Central Bearded Dragon (Pogona vitticeps)
Group: Outback Pack

Ozzie is a Central Bearded Dragon which comes from the heart of Australia. Bearded Dragons are medium sized arboreal lizards often found on top of fence post and in trees. They are opportunistic omnivores that absolutely love to eat bugs. Ozzie is an easy going dragon and is often the lizard we use to help people feel more comfortable with reptiles. His favorite food is crickets, dubia roaches and spring mix. He was adopted from a rescue in Houston called Gina's Heart of Gold Reptile Rescue. He spends most of his time basking in his massive Pop-up Chameleon enclosure taking in the Texas sun. Ozzie is a member of our Australian Big 3.
